golang经典电子书合集
发布时间:2024-11-05 20:30:47
Golang——开启高效编程之旅
自从Google在2009年发布了Golang(也称为Go)编程语言以来,它一直受到开发者们的热爱和赞誉。Golang是一种面向现代应用程序开发的静态类型、编译型语言。它的设计初衷是要提供一种简单、高效、可靠的语言,以便开发人员能够快速构建可扩展的应用程序。这篇文章将介绍一些经典的电子书合集,帮助你从一个专业的Golang开发者的角度深入了解这门语言。
1.《Go语言程序设计》
这本经典的书籍由Alan A.A.Donovan和Brian W.Kernighan联合撰写。它以通俗易懂的方式介绍了Golang的基本概念和语法。书中涵盖的主题包括变量、函数、类型、并发等,并通过丰富的示例代码帮助读者更好地理解Golang的特性。如果你是一个新手,这本书将是你入门学习的最佳选择。
2.《Go并发编程实战》
该书由Katherine Cox-Buday编写,重点介绍了Golang中的并发编程。并发是Golang的一大特色,并且被广泛应用于构建高效的网络和分布式系统。这本书从基础的并发概念开始介绍,逐步深入到更高级的主题,如协程、通道、互斥锁等。无论你是想了解Golang并发编程的基础知识还是提高你的并发编程技巧,这本书都值得一读。
3.《Go Web编程》
写出高性能网络应用是许多开发者的目标之一,而Golang正是为此而生。《Go Web编程》由Sau Sheong Chang编写,提供了全面的指南来构建Web应用程序。这本书覆盖了HTTP基础、路由器、模板、数据库等关键主题,并给出了一些实际项目示例。通过学习这本书,你将掌握使用Golang构建出高性能Web应用程序的技能。
4.《Mastering Go》
作者Mihalis Tsoukalos以实例驱动的方式介绍了Golang的一些高级特性和最佳实践。这本书涵盖了Golang中的反射、接口使用、包管理等主题,并提供了许多实际的示例代码。无论你是一个经验丰富的Golang开发者还是初学者,这本书都能够帮助你更好地掌握Golang的核心概念。
在这篇文章中,我们简要介绍了几本经典的Golang电子书合集,涵盖了从基础知识到高级应用的内容。通过学习这些书籍,你可以系统地提升自己的Golang编程能力,并能够更好地应用于实际项目开发中。
总之,Golang是一门强大而灵活的编程语言,在当今云计算和分布式系统的背景下特别受欢迎。无论你是一个新手还是一个有丰富经验的开发者,学习Golang都将为你的职业发展带来巨大的机会。希望这篇文章对你了解和学习Golang有所帮助!
相关推荐